Job Description
Brown University Athletics is seeking candidates for the Athletics Photography Assistant. This position will be tasked with photographing games, practices, and other events as they arise.
Located in Providence, Rhode Island, and a member of the Ivy League, our intercollegiate athletics program consists of 34 varsity teams with approximately 1,000 athletes who participate within the National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A-DI).
Responsibilities- Shooting and editing photos at live athletic events such as games and practices
- Shooting and editing photos of other events as they arise
- Access to own camera and other photography equipment
- Access to own computer for editing purposes
- Ability to work nights and weekends
